Rapid and reliable fault detection is critical for the safe and economic operation of complex industrial systems like aircraft and locomotives. A metric for quantifying the performance of fault detection systems is important for selecting and optimizing such systems. Anomaly detection provides an early warning of unusual behavior in units in a fleet operating in a dynamic environment by learning system characteristics from normal operational data and flagging any unanticipated or unseen patterns. Change detection is an important task for remote monitoring, fault diagnostics and system prognostics. When a fault occurs, it will often times cause changes in measurable quantities of the system.
